Page 229 - BUKU TEKS SK T4
P. 229
• Memastikan setiap rekod lama yang tersimpan tidak bertindih
dengan rekod baharu.
• Memberikan identiti yang unik bagi setiap rekod yang disimpan di
dalam pangkalan data.
• Menjadikan data yang disimpan adalah utuh kerana setiap
rekodnya mempunyai satu nilai yang unik sebagai pengenalan
Kepentingan diri.
• Mengelakkan berlakunya pertindihan data daripada rekod
yang sama berulang-ulang disimpan di dalam pangkalan data.
Seterusnya, dapat menjimatkan ruang stor komputer.
• Memudahkan proses carian dan capaian atas rekod. Rekod
yang hendak dicari boleh dicapai dengan membuat carian
menggunakan kunci primer.
Kunci asing ialah atribut yang mengandungi nilai kunci primer
daripada jadual sasaran. Dengan kata lain, untuk menghasilkan hubungan
di antara dua jadual, jadual yang ingin mewujudkan hubungan akan
menambahkan atribut kunci primer daripada jadual sasaran sebagai kunci
asing. Lihat Rajah 2.25 di bawah.
Jadual PINJAMAN
Kunci primer Kunci asing
Uji Minda
Setelah mempelajari
mengenai kunci primer
dan kunci asing, nyatakan
perbezaan antara kunci
primer dan kunci asing.
Jadual PEMINJAM
Kunci primer
Primary key vs foreign key
goo.gl/0oah1m
Rajah 2.25 Hubungan antara kunci primer dan kunci asing yang menggunakan contoh jadual
hubungan PINJAMAN dan PEMINJAM
Sains Komputer Tingkatan 4
220

